Prayagraj: A fake improvised explosive device (IED) caused panic among the locals near a railway under bridge (RUB) located at Rewa road of Naini on Saturday morning.
On getting the news, police cordoned off the area and diverted traffic as members of the bomb disposal and anti-terrorist squads reached the area. However, investigation revealed that a fake IED resembling a time bomb, made by using water bottles had been put at the site by some unidentified miscreant, police said.
Efforts have now begun to identify and nab the culprit, they added.
SSP-Prayagraj Ajay Kumar confirmed the incident and said it seems to be a mischievous act by someone deliberately trying to create panic.
“Everything is normal. We are now trying to identify the culprit with the help of CCTV cameras in the vicinity,” he added.
According to reports, Rambabu, a rag picker spotted a circuit-like object in bottles near a RUB close to Leprosy crossing on Rewa Road in Naini on Saturday morning and informed a nearby tea seller. The tea seller in turn informed the police.
Within moments, a police team reached the spot followed by senior officials including SSP Ajay Kumar, SP trans-Yamuna Saurabh Dixit and bomb disposal squad. Following the protocol, the police cordoned off the area and diverted all traffic for a while. The bomb disposal squad conducted investigation using a bomb detector. The members of the bomb disposal team also went on an alert when a timer was detected. However, when the bomb disposal team opened the packet, they found it to be a fake IED.
Police said the culprit had used disposable water bottles and even installed a timer connected by inserting an electric wire in it. The bottles were pasted with red color tape giving it an overall appearance of genuine IED.
It is worth mentioning that in 2016-17 also many such fake IEDs were found in different areas of the district including Meja. However, the police had failed to find the culprit.
